Transaction 16f723af043ba3bf39389d69dfc3dc1f9dfd5cea81f2025e01da1592b4e219d3

2 Input
1 Outputs
  • 16f723af043ba3bf39389d69dfc3dc1f9dfd5cea81f2025e01da1592b4e219d3:0
  • value  5269891
    address  36nK4FK8KDZvzxmE8VKAgxorFXjvfdnGN1